2. Minimalist Golf Course Line Art
These pieces feature clean, single-line drawings or simple geometric representations of famous golf holes or course layouts. They prioritize negative space and essential forms, fitting perfectly into minimalist and Scandinavian-inspired interiors.
- Description: Simple, elegant line drawings that abstractly depict famous golf holes or course layouts.
- Pros: Highly versatile, unobtrusive, complements a wide range of modern decor, affordable.
- Cons: May lack the detail some enthusiasts desire, can be too simple for some tastes.
- Who it's best for: Those with minimalist or Scandinavian decor, individuals who prefer subtle nods to their interests, and smaller spaces where a less imposing piece is preferred.
3. Abstract Golf Swing Canvases
These artworks capture the motion and energy of a golf swing through abstract brushstrokes, color palettes, and dynamic compositions. They offer a more artistic and less literal interpretation of the sport, adding a splash of color and energy to a room.
- Description: Energetic and colorful abstract paintings that convey the essence of a golf swing's movement.
- Pros: Visually striking, adds color and vibrancy, appeals to art lovers as much as golfers.
- Cons: Can be polarizing depending on the abstract style, may not immediately read as "golf" to a casual observer.
- Who it's best for: Contemporary and eclectic interiors, art collectors who also play golf, and those looking to make a bold artistic statement.
4. Black and White Golf Photography
High-contrast black and white photographs of iconic golf moments, players, or landscapes offer a timeless and sophisticated appeal. The monochromatic scheme makes them incredibly adaptable to modern color palettes and adds a classic, artistic feel.
- Description: Striking black and white images capturing the drama, beauty, or iconic figures of golf.
- Pros: Timeless aesthetic, sophisticated, easy to match with existing decor, highlights form and texture.
- Cons: Lacks color, might feel too "traditional" if not presented in a contemporary style or frame.
- Who it's best for: Modern monochrome rooms, lovers of classic photography, and those who appreciate subtle elegance.

6. Golf Course Aerial Maps
These are often stylized, artistic renderings or detailed aerial photographs of famous golf courses. They appeal to the strategic and geographical aspect of the game, offering a sophisticated, infographic-like visual.
- Description: Detailed artistic renditions or photographic views of well-known golf courses from above.
- Pros: Intellectually stimulating, visually detailed, unique conversation piece, appeals to the strategic side of golf.
- Cons: Can be very specific, might require a larger wall space for optimal viewing.
- Who it's best for: Golf course aficionados, designers who appreciate detailed maps, and spaces looking for a unique focal point.

How do I choose golf wall art that fits my specific modern interior design?
Consider your home's color scheme, existing furniture style, and the overall vibe you want to create. If your space is very sleek and neutral, a bold abstract piece or a sophisticated black and white photograph might work best. For a warmer modern feel, consider watercolor-style pieces or carefully selected vintage reproductions.
